Railway trains on the south and west tribes stand still after an accident at Katrineholm, according to a press release from the Swedish transport administration. Traffic at Stockholm C-Norrköping-Malmö / Copenhagen, Stockholm C-Hallsberg-Gothenburg / Karlstad / Oslo and Linköping-Norrköping-Katrineholm-Eskilstuna-Västerås-Sala have been affected.
The rescue service is called for accidents and traffic is not expected to start again earlier than 13 hours.
Residents are advised to contact their train service for more information.
